NBC CHIEF EXPECTS MORE ADVERTISING WITHIN TV SHOWS
[SOURCE: Reuters 9/25]
NBC Universal Chief Executive Bob Wright on Monday predicted more advertising will occur within television shows in the coming years -- through sponsorship or product placement -- as ad-skipping devices become more popular. "The skipping issue is going to have a lot of different dimensions," said Wright, speaking at an Advertising Week event in New York. One outcome, he said, would be that "advertisements will move more into the program." Wright said another outcome is the increasing importance of event programming, such as this year's winter Olympics, which ran on NBC. "I couldn't be happier with what he have," Wright said, referring to NBC's Olympics coverage. "This is one of those scarcity issues. In a world with more options, premium properties really stand out." Wright also pointed to NBC's Sunday Night Football, which premiered this year. "Having football as a cornerstone on Sunday night takes pressure off our scheduling," he said.
